Output caafcf0675e61fd844bcb4479700b71f6c8785be96f4d9cfd5a63b93e834b149:1

value
615795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98468155aaff583a45a2c0bfd127015d3e70a762 OP_EQUAL
address
3FaB6VNusy296CvCi3QzyZ2k2FbenXGQmJ
transaction
caafcf0675e61fd844bcb4479700b71f6c8785be96f4d9cfd5a63b93e834b149
confirmations
167705
spent
true